1.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device by your web browser.
They allow websites to:
- Remember your preferences
- Keep you signed in
- Improve website performance
- Understand how visitors use the Service
- Provide security features
Some cookies are placed directly by CarbonFreeLife ("first-party cookies"), while others are placed by trusted third-party providers ("third-party cookies").

8. Do Not Track (DNT)
Some browsers offer a "Do Not Track" (DNT) setting. Because there is currently no universally accepted industry standard for responding to DNT signals, CarbonFreeLife does not respond differently based solely on a DNT signal.
